Solution Overview

Problem

Adjusting the values of control items in a sheet embellishing system to affect the total light intensity of UV rays for varnish irradiation is burdensome for users.

Innovation Solution

A sheet embellishing system that includes a control device which acquires adhesivity-related information and correlates it with control item values to execute processing, reducing user burden by proposing UV emission intensity candidates based on past job history.

AI summary

A sheet embellishing system performs embellishment on a sheet while conveying the sheet. The sheet embellishing system includes a varnish-applying unit that applies varnish having ultraviolet (UV) curability onto the sheet, a UV irradiation unit that irradiates the varnish on the sheet by UV rays, and a control device. The control device acquires, from a storage unit that stores adhesivity-related information that is information relating to adhesivity between the varnish on the sheet and a transfer material that is to be transferred into the varnish on the sheet, and a value regarding a control item of the sheet embellishing system, in a correlated manner, a value of the control item of which the adhesivity-related information corresponds to the adhesivity-related information of a current job, and executes predetermined processing using the value of the control item that is acquired.
